Transaction 56acdda975468ff7fd9a9c072cf48b8d0d430f61dce6fc346e95f85cc4374b36

37 Input
2 Outputs
  • 56acdda975468ff7fd9a9c072cf48b8d0d430f61dce6fc346e95f85cc4374b36:0
  • value  82455014
    address  179sjsVFfD54y3TUkRkHkaSKoizDM5viJN
  • 56acdda975468ff7fd9a9c072cf48b8d0d430f61dce6fc346e95f85cc4374b36:1
  • value  2224120657
    address  3BMEX1YSQwvh6rFBVavsHfyJksDL85vZHG